Painted & Reinstalled the XJ Shock Hoops / “Bed Cage”. Got the reservoirs mounted temporarily until I decide where they’ll go and get proper hardware in place. Here’s a few more pictures after paint:
King Air Bumpstops fitted and sleeved through the XJ rear unibody rails. The upper thread and schrader service valve stick just through the floorboards.
This is a set of 2” x 2” king bumpstops. Similar to a typical Jeepspeed XJ configuration.
Test cycling the xj suspension to check everything clears. Have the travel running a full 10” - with a ~1” down travel cushion to account for limit strap stretch, and a 1” up travel cushion at full bump. Keep the shocks happy for years to come.

More little details while waiting on parts. Started cleaning up the leaf springs.
These were originally from a junkyard pull and never got the full service they should have. Rubicon Express 3.5” Superflex Full Leaf Packs (RE1463).
Prepped, soon to be painted.
Got the lower shock mounts cut and welded today. These will tie into the leaf spring U-bolt plates on the XJ.
